The DESTACO family of products consists of industry-leading brands such as DESTACO Manual and Power Clamps, Camco and Ferguson Indexers, Robohand Grippers and CRL Manipulators and Transfer Ports. DESTACO is based in Auburn Hills, Michigan, and operates globally through ~800 employees across 13 locations. Dover is a diversified global manufacturer with annual revenues of $7 billion. Engineering jobs encompass a vast array of specialized roles within the field of engineering, aimed at designing, developing, and maintaining various technological systems and structures. These roles typically require a strong foundation in mathematics and science, and they span across numerous sectors such as civil, mechanical, electrical, and software engineering, among others. The key features of engineering careers include problem-solving, innovation, and the application of practical knowledge to create solutions that can improve people's lives, enhance business operations, or even address global challenges. Engineers often work in teams, collaborate with other professionals, and are at the forefront of technological advancement.
Engineering jobs encompass a broad range of professions that involve the application of science and mathematics to solve problems and design, construct, and maintain structures, devices, and systems. These jobs are characterized by creativity, analytical skills, and the pursuit of technological innovation. Engineers can specialize in various fields, such as civil, mechanical, electrical, software, or biomedical engineering, each with its distinctive focus and techniques. A hallmark of engineering roles is their impact on shaping our built environment and the way we interact with technology, making them crucial for the advancement and sustainability of modern societies.
